Hey guys..

I download the mod and extract it into mods. I enable it.. and when I start the game it still says.. single age mod.dm must be enabled.

Help?

Edratman October 27th, 2008 05:28 PM

Re: Single Age
 
Go the mods directory and see if the .dm file is within a folder within the mods folder. If it is, copy the .dm file and paste the copy within the mods folder. Then delete the folder containing the .dm file.

Slobby October 27th, 2008 06:40 PM

Re: Single Age mod
 
The issue is that llamaserver is using single age mod (aka singleagecomplete), it's the same mod llama just used a different name, which i believe he will be correcting in the future. All you have to do in the interim is rename singleagecomplete to single age mod.

I was thinking about that putting EA and LA nations in the same age have a slight balance problem with starting gem income, late game nations getting only 4 versus 6 of EA ones.

IMO the gem income of MA/LA nations should be brought up to EA level.

Zeldor May 19th, 2009 04:44 AM

Re: Single Age
 
That's what I'm planning to do in my Enhanced Gameplay Mod. But it may be better to be in that mod.

Gandalf Parker May 19th, 2009 02:50 PM

Re: Single Age
 
I believe that the concept is that magic is more prevalent in the early age and kindof waters down in later ages.

In any case, I wouldnt add it to the SingleAge mod which seeks to only fill one purpose, and lets other mods handle the rest. There really isnt much reason to try and put everything into a single mod.
